several symptoms, no clue
it's a 93 mx3 b6me, 5spd, 197,5xx miles. if you let the car idle for a minute before shutting it off, it will smoke like hell the next time it's started cold. it's white smoke, but it's not oil or coolant, it's incomplete combustion. it won't do it if you shut it off right away, but if you sit and idle at all, it will do it. it's like it's idling too rich or something, but it passed emissions just fine. if it was rich, wouldn't it take longer to warm up? it actually warms up pretty quick. also, there is a "surging" under acceleration, like the power comes and goes. it was trying to stall on me last week, and it did stall once or twice, but when I actually shut it off with the key and restarted it, it ran just like always. no stalling since. I don't get it.

Re: several symptoms, no clue
well, running rich is black smoke.
burning oil is blueish
and coolant/really cold days is white.
So unless its really cold, which I don't think it is anywhere (that you can drive) on the planet right now, I'd say its coolant.
Check your coolant resevoir, see if its brackish/oily, or low.
Also, these cars run rich when cold. Its designed that way, thats why we have thermosensors. The purpose is likely both for ignition and heating purposes, but I'm not a Mazda engineer.
Concerning your problem, have you tried a tune up? filters, plugs, wires, cap and rotor, set ignition timing/idle speed, maybe a good 'ol can of seafoam...

Re: several symptoms, no clue
On my wideband o2 , no matter what load below roughly 4k rpms the afr stays the same vs 4500+ both at part and WOT.
Dosent matter if i go up a steep hill in 4th or second below 4k its the same afr, once over 4k though the afr drops.
Alot of miata guys have problems running aftermarket turbo kits and its why they use an o2 clamp
